TVS - Diodes
Transient Voltage Suppression (TVS) diodes are compact,high-speed, efficient, reliable and cost-effective devices designedto protect equipment from overloads and short circuits in a varietyof circuit applications. They are generally used to protect printedcircuit boards and integrated circuit (IC) from overvoltage transients(like ESD), lightning transients and line transients.
